Output 2f1f364068d2b3fa34c4b6486c5859b20c8c19ded1d606a16015107359807a4e:1

value
10488566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10ae1fd1a3d3c9dab9cc168cc6cb78d457343f89 OP_EQUAL
address
33DDKyrJQhB7bYNx1Cax2M4R2hqWJWUAbi
transaction
2f1f364068d2b3fa34c4b6486c5859b20c8c19ded1d606a16015107359807a4e
confirmations
294076
spent
true